Governor Announces Real Estate is Essential

Governor Greg Abbott issued an executive order on March 31 setting a statewide standard for essential services that may continue to be provided, including residential and commercial real estate. Read Gov. Abbott’s order that utilizes the U.S. Department of Homeland Security’s guidelines for identifying essential services, which includes real estate highlighted on Page 13. Here are some key points:

  • Supersedes existing local orders only where those local orders may have previously restricted essential services or where they were more permissive on gatherings
  • Even for essential services, telework or online work should be used as much as possible, limiting in-person contact (following CDC guidelines) unless absolutely necessary

This is a positive step for Texas REALTORS®, as real estate professionals statewide may continue to serve clients while demonstrating care for the health and well-being of the greater public welfare. REALTORS® worked with Gov. Abbott and other industry groups to ensure real estate was an essential service statewide.
